Daily sudoku: Take a break with this classic numbers puzzle

The world of science news never sleeps, but even we need to take a break every now and then. And what better way than to give our collective brains a good workout with sudoku?

The rules are simple: Each row, column and 3 x 3 box must contain the numbers 1 to 9, with no repeats. Sounds simple, right? Sometimes it is; other times, it’s a little more challenging. (That’s when tapping the hints button comes in handy.) Regardless, it’s a great way to step back for a bit and crunch some numbers.
